i don't think you should wear a black tie. what about maroon or dark red? i personally love the way maroon looks with grey. i also see navy or a dark green color working well with the grey. paisley is a nice pattern for ties. i love olive green. i tend to like smaller paisley but i have more lare paisley printed ties. college stripes, i think they're called, look okay but they tend to be pretty bland to me. polka dot ties are nice also. if you go on ebay and search 'knit ties' you will find a nice variety of those (i have bought 4 in the past month or so). herringbone patterned ties look pretty cool too. but, you should really go to a bunch of clothing places and scope out ties that YOU think look good with what you'll be wearing. in the end, you should be wearing something that YOU like.
